Desolation

This mod aims to create a more realistic worldbuilding experience while still providing Points of Interest (POIs) for players who enjoy exploring and grinding.

The first change restricts points of interest with human habitation to planets inside the settled systems, to those with breathable atmospheres outside, or to those with life. This aligns with the lore and makes settlers' decisions more logical, resulting in a more empty galaxy, as it should be. This change significantly reduces the number of randomly encountered human POIs while still leaving an infinite number to be found in the core worlds.

The POIs generated for radiant quests are unaffected, so there is still an infinite number to find, and each is more unique, as they will all have a context behind them. Locations you find on planet scans will also still show up, meaning each habitable planet still has some life, just not an infinite amount. As an added benefit, the Crimson Fleet is no longer the largest faction in the Settled Systems, with hundreds of bases on every planet.
